The Starlink Revolution: Connectivity Without Borders
What Is Starlink Direct-to-Cell Technology?
At the heart of the Tesla Pi Phone lies Starlink Direct-to-Cell technology, developed by SpaceX. This innovation allows smartphones to connect directly to satellites orbiting Earth, eliminating the need for traditional cell towers.
How It Changes Everything
Imagine using your phone:
- In remote villages
- On mountain tops
- In deserts or oceans
Without worrying about signal bars.
This technology enables a phone to switch between 4G, 5G, and satellite networks seamlessly—just like switching between Wi-Fi and mobile data today.

Regaining Control: A Practical Guide for 2026
You don’t need to wait for the Tesla Pi Phone to take control of your digital life. Here are actionable steps you can implement today.
1. Own Your Contacts
Your contacts are one of your most valuable digital assets.
How to Export Contacts
- Android Users:
- Open Contacts app
- Tap Export
- Save as a VCF file
- iPhone Users:
- Use iCloud settings
- Export your contact list
Best Storage Practices
- Email the file to yourself
- Save it on a USB drive
- Keep a backup in cloud storage
This ensures your data remains independent of any carrier.
2. Embrace eSIM Technology
Modern smartphones now support eSIM, which allows you to:
- Switch carriers digitally in minutes
- Avoid physical SIM cards
- Manage multiple numbers on one device
This is a crucial step toward carrier independence.

The 2FA Danger Zone: What You Must Know
What Is 2FA (Two-Factor Authentication)?
2FA adds an extra layer of security by sending a verification code to your phone number.
While useful, it becomes a major risk during number transitions.
The Biggest Mistake People Make
Deactivating your old number too early can result in:
- Locked bank accounts
- Lost access to apps
- Delayed identity verification
Verification codes get sent to a number that no longer exists.
How to Avoid Getting Locked Out
Follow these critical steps:
1. Test Everything First
- Log into all important apps on your new device
- Ensure 2FA works correctly
2. Keep Your Old Number Active
- Maintain it for at least 7 days
- Use it as a backup for verification codes
3. Update All Accounts
- Banks
- Government portals
- Insurance apps
- Email services
This simple process can save you days of frustration.
